How can the UK’s politicians re-engage the public’s trust?

Author: Chris Whitson, Stephens Francis Whitson
Date: 12 February 2010

Getting to the point is a priority for every marketer - and currently, the UK's politicians. Chris Whitson presents a party-neutral and focused business plan for beleaguered party politicians who need to restore their 'brand credibility' with a disillusioned public.

He uses the Japanese rapid-fire presentation style of Pecha Kucha – 20 slides and 20 seconds per slide – to highlight the valuable lessons politicians can learn from successful commercial brands such as Tesco, ASDA and Apple.
